The Power of Journaling for Mental HealthJournaling has long been known for its therapeutic benefits. Studies show that expressive writing can reduce stress, enhance emotional well-being, and increase self-awareness. According to the American Psychological Association, writing about feelings and experiences can help people make sense of their emotions, improving mental health over time. This simple practice allows individuals to put their thoughts and feelings on paper, giving them an opportunity to reflect and process.
How Journaling Helps During Global Events- Helps Manage Anxiety: Writing about worries can reduce anxiety by transforming overwhelming thoughts into manageable pieces.
- Encourages Reflection: Journaling allows you to step back from the noise of global events and evaluate what matters most to you.
- Fosters Emotional Clarity: Through writing, you can explore complicated emotions, helping to bring clarity and relief.
- Promotes Mindfulness: Journaling encourages you to be present with your thoughts and feelings, reducing stress and promoting mental well-being.
Research consistently supports the idea that journaling can improve mental health. In a study conducted by Dr. James Pennebaker, a pioneer in expressive writing research, participants who wrote about their emotions showed lower levels of stress and improved immune function. This suggests that journaling not only helps clear your mind but also boosts your physical well-being.
